Originally Posted by Halfcent
I would recommend returning to your stock cams and using the adjustable gears on them. Forced induction cam timing is really more important then cam lift, and the gears will allow that.

Did you know the only difference between LSJ cams and L61 cams are the timing? They have the exact same grind.
